i am still unclear why the bronco sport was launched so smoothly and the bronco has stalled. But whatev
Because Bronco is a much more complicated and unique product vs. Bronco Sport, which is effectively a rebodied Escape, which itself has been out for over a year already. While it's different from Escape, a lot of it is similar, so production processes and things were already worked out for it, compared to something all new with Bronco.

It’s not like Ford is the only car manufacturer having these issues. GM had to stop selling the Corvette because of commodity restraints. Many 2021 Corvette buyers are going to me MY2022 buyers. I am just happy things are working their way back to normal, and not worsening. Soon enough.
